Description

Summary

This module presents an introduction to research into the diagnosis, developmental mechanism, prevention and treatment of birth defects at the ¹û¶³Ó°Ôº Great Ormond Street Institute of Child Health. You will be provided with a biological overview of normal embryonic development, working systematically through the organ systems and highlighting genes and mechanisms by which congenital malformations and/or birth defects arise. Ìý

Leading clinicians and scientists will present their efforts to translate progress made into the understanding of the molecular mechanisms underlying birth defects into the development of novel therapeutic strategies. Ìý

Leaning Objectives and Outcomes

The aim of this module is to provide you with knowledge of normal embryology and disorders arising from abnormal development. By taking this module, you will be able to:Ìý

  1. Gain specialist knowledge in embryology and developmental biologyÌý

  1. Increase familiarity with key developmental genes pathwaysÌý

  1. Describe abnormal development leading to congenital malformationsÌý

  1. Explain the underlying genetic and molecular pathology of birth defectsÌý

  1. Describe research methods to determine the diagnosis, prevention and treatment of birth defectsÌý

  1. Outline novel intervention strategies for common birth defectsÌý

  1. Appreciate diverse approaches to therapy developmentÌý

  1. Stimulate further research into developmental biology and birth defectsÌý
